Tags or Khos to chasing team-mates are generally made on the back, between the shoulder and waist. If a teammate extends his arm or feet for a Kho, it is deemed illegal. However, they can tag one of their fellow inactive chasers while uttering the word ‘Kho’ to hand over the chase to them. The instant a ‘Kho’ is made, the tagged chaser becomes the active chaser and the one who gives the ‘Kho’ becomes inactive and has to sit down in the now active chaser’s position. Eight players take a sitting position, crouched in the eight small rectangles formed by the intersection of the central and cross lanes. Points earned in each turn are cumulative, and the final score determines the winner. The process is time-bound and regulated, with short breaks allowed between turns. A chaser can only run in the direction in which they take their first step in, also called taking direction.
Number of Total Players on a Team
As per international, national level… In the game of Kho Kho, 12 players from each team play the match of Kho Kho. But out of these 12 players, only 9 from each team play on the field and the rest 3 are on the bench or considered substitutes. When a chaser tags a defender, the chasing team earns a point, and the tagged defender leaves the field.
